OVERVIEW: KPMG in India, a professional services firm, is the Indian member firm affiliated with KPMG International and was established in September 1993. Our professionals leverage the global network of firms, providing detailed knowledge of local laws, regulations, markets, and competition. KPMG has offices across India in Ahmedabad, Bengaluru, Chandigarh, Chennai, Gurugram, Hyderabad, Jaipur, Kochi, Kolkata, Mumbai, Noida, Pune, and Vadodara. KPMG in India offers services to national and international clients in India across sectors. We strive to provide rapid, performance-based, industry-focussed, and technology-enabled services, which reflect a shared knowledge of global and local industries and our experience of the Indian business environment KPMG Advisory professionals provide advice and assistance to enable companies, intermediaries, and public sector bodies to mitigate risk, improve performance, and create value. KPMG firms provide a wide range of Risk Advisory and Financial Advisory Services that can help clients respond to immediate needs as well as put in place the strategies for the longer term. Projects in IT Advisory focus on the assessment and/or evaluation of IT systems and the mitigation of IT-related business risks. They are either IS audit, SOX reviews, Internal audit engagements, IT infrastructure review and/or risk advisory including but not limited to IT audit supports in nature.
